What is the present tense of bridged?

What's the present tense of bridged? Here's the word you're looking for.

Answer

The present tense of bridged is bridge.

The third-person singular simple present indicative form of bridge is bridges.

The present participle of bridge is bridging.

The past participle of bridge is bridged.
